    With Google's inclusion of first-class support for Kotlin in their Android
    ecosystem, Kotlin's future as a mainstream language is assured. Microservices help
    design scalable, easy-to-maintain web applications; Kotlin allows us to take
    advantage of modern idioms to simplify our development and create high-quality
    services. With 100% interoperability with the JVM, Kotlin makes working with
    existing Java code easier. Well-known Java systems such as Spring, Jackson, and
    Reactor have included Kotlin modules to exploit its language features.
    This book guides the reader in designing and implementing services, and producing
    production-ready, testable, lean code that's shorter and simpler than a traditional
    Java implementation. Reap the benefits of using the reactive paradigm and take
    advantage of non-blocking techniques to take your services to the next level in terms
    of industry standards. You will consume NoSQL databases reactively to allow you
    to create high-throughput microservices. Create cloud-native microservices that
    can run on a wide range of cloud providers, and monitor them. You will create Docker
    containers for your microservices and scale them. Finally, you will deploy your
    microservices in OpenShift Online.

    O autorze ebooka

    Juan Antonio Medina Iglesias began his career 20 years ago as an indie game developer and worked abroad four countries since then, from embedded software to enterprise applications. He has a lifetime's dedication to software craftsmanship. Since 2006, he works at Santander Technology with a talented group of professionals who performed one of the biggest transformations in the banking industry. Nowadays, he works as a Senior Engineer in the Digital Transformation team within Santander Technology UK.
